Employability Manager is a solid choice for organizations that need to systematically track, assess, and develop employee skills and competencies, especially in regulated or skills-driven industries. Its standout feature is the granular mapping of education, certifications, and competencies across your workforce, making it particularly valuable for compliance-heavy sectors or companies with complex training requirements. However, the platform's depth means setup and ongoing management can be resource-intensive, and smaller teams may find it more than they need. Pricing is generally aligned with mid-market and enterprise budgets, so it's best suited for organizations that can leverage its robust analytics and reporting to drive real business value.

Implementation requires careful planning, especially for mapping existing skills frameworks and integrating with HRIS or LMS systems; expect a moderate learning curve for admins.
Best managed by a dedicated HR or L&D function with IT support for integrations; ongoing success depends on regular input from department managers and training coordinators.
Designed to handle hundreds to thousands of employees; excels when tracking large volumes of training data, certifications, and skill assessments.
